REPORT
Approval of the recommended action will transfer two Stock Clerk positions from the Internal Services Department (ISD) to the Probation Department (Probation). Both positions currently support Probation full-time and transferring the positions will provide better oversight and control of staff duties and responsibilities related to inventory processes for Probation. This item is countywide.

ALTERNATIVE ACTION(S):

Should your Board not approve the recommended action, the two positions will continue supporting the Probation Department while being employed by ISD, which creates challenges with personnel matters and differing departmental policies.

FISCAL IMPACT:

There is no increase in Net County Cost associated with the recommended action. Sufficient appropriations and estimated revenues are included in Probation's Org 3440 FY 2024-25 Adopted Budget and will be included in future budget requests.

DISCUSSION:

On December 10, 2019, the Board approved an amendment to the Salary Resolution, which transferred a total of 14 positions from Probation to ISD. These positions consisted of 11 janitorial and 3 Stock Clerk positions and were transferred as their functions were more aligned with ISD. During this time, ISD managed a warehouse stocked with inventories that supported both Facilities and operations at the Juvenile Justice Campus (JJC).
